
Como funcionan casi todas las cosas
Celina works at a remote tollbooth on a desert road, few days before Christmas, her father dies and Celina becomes a door-to-door encyclopedia saleswoman so she can earn enough money to travel to Italy and find her mom.

💡 Did You Know?
Both Fernando Salem and Esteban Garelli, director and screenwriter of the film, graduated from the same film school, ENERC in Buenos Aires.
